Output 650dff6d53dc15e55f089cdfee0a4e09ddb481715f14666fdd4286f01ac46625:1

value
18391156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8664b2e8ece16ff4d9d6d61afd90427d4bf4b01a OP_EQUALVERIFY OP_CHECKSIG
address
1DFcBPLnXADZUPV5LbcvnHoR3kJhqT9niw
transaction
650dff6d53dc15e55f089cdfee0a4e09ddb481715f14666fdd4286f01ac46625
confirmations
510738
spent
true